Output 7c6125b5e9e962cb89f04bec57014e52f0ba20bec4ffb13f5abc0f5a23956642:7

value
16467127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c4a785a58f108bf6b55a121caddd3ebffafd80d OP_EQUAL
address
MTyx6udBx6svcuWagmnndFyRkBrPwPssRu
transaction
7c6125b5e9e962cb89f04bec57014e52f0ba20bec4ffb13f5abc0f5a23956642
spent
true